WEST MARINE BESTS 2003 EARNINGS GUIDANCE
WATSONVILLE, CA, February 19, 2004 - West Marine, Inc. (Nasdaq: WMAR) today reported net income for the year ended January 3, 2004 of $20.1 million, or $0.99 per share, an increase of 6.3% compared to net income of $18.9 million, or $0.97 per share, a year ago. Excluding $2.8 million in pre-tax costs related to the acquisition of certain BoatU.S. operations, or $0.08 per share after-tax, net income for 2003 would have been $21.8 million, or $1.07 per share. This exceeds previously issued guidance ranging from $1.03 to $1.05 per share. Acquisition-related costs include $0.9 million for incremental costs incurred to integrate the newly acquired operations of BoatU.S. and $1.9 million for early debt extinguishment costs incurred to finance the acquisition.
Net sales for the fifty-three weeks ended January 3, 2004 were $660.9 million, up 24.6% from $530.6 million for the fifty-two weeks ended December 28, 2002. Comparable store net sales for 2003 decreased 2.5% compared to the similar period a year ago. Sales from the 62 BoatU.S. stores acquired in January 2003 are included in total sales, but are not reflected in comparable store sales statistics for 2003. BoatU.S. stores acquired in January 2003 will be included in the comparable store sales base beginning in March 2004. Comparable store sales are defined as sales from stores that have been open at least thirteen months and where selling square footage did not change by more than 40% in the previous thirteen months.
The Company’s net loss for the fourth quarter ended January 3, 2004 was ($1.6 million), or ($0.08) per share, compared to a net loss of ($1.4 million), or ($0.07) per share, a year ago. Net sales for the fourteen weeks ended January 3, 2004 were $124.9 million, up 34.8% from $92.7 million for the thirteen weeks ended December 28, 2002. Comparable store net sales for the fourth quarter increased 2.9% compared to the similar period a year ago.
Results for both the fourth quarter and the year 2003 include an income tax benefit of approximately $0.3 million, or $0.01 per share, related to the recognition of state tax credits.
John Edmondson, West Marine’s chief executive officer, stated, “We are pleased with our fourth quarter results, which compare favorably with our previously issued guidance of a loss of ($0.09) to ($0.11) per share, primarily due to good gross margins. February sales have started off strongly, continuing the trend established by our previously reported January results.”
West Marine, Inc. is the nation’s largest specialty retailer of boating supplies and apparel, with 346 stores in 38 states, Canada and Puerto Rico, and more than $650 million in annual sales. The Company’s successful Catalog and Internet channels offer customers approximately 50,000 products – far more than any competitor – and the convenience of being able to exchange Catalog and Internet purchases at its retail stores. The Company’s Port Supply division is the country’s largest wholesale distributor of marine equipment serving boat manufacturers, marine services, commercial vessel operators and government agencies. Because the overwhelming majority of West Marine’s revenues come from aftermarket sales, the Company has traditionally been less affected by economic downturns than manufacturers and sellers of new boats.
